Hello all,
I have been running my forum without any problems for some time now. However today at around 11:50 the site went down for around 30 seconds (currently being investigated by the host). When it came back everything seems to be working fine apart from the times on forum activity.
For example, a post made today at 13:46 is showing as 12:46
I have run the following PHP on the server:
Code:
$date = date( "d/m/Y H:i", time() );
echo $date
and this displays the correct GMT time (i.e. 30/04/2008 13:07 when executed at real world time of 14:07 (as the UK is currently GMT+1))
Also when the server came back after the blip users were seeing messages like:
"This forum requires that you wait 30 seconds between searches. Please try again in 663 seconds."
Does anybody have any ideas on how to resolve this?
EDIT : This is effecting both guests and registered users
EDIT : if it helps at all these are my ACP Date and Time Options
Datestamp Display Option - Yesterday / Today
Default Time Zone Offset - (GMT) Western Europe Time, London, Lisbon, Casablanca
Enable Daylight Savings - Yes
Format For Date - d-m-y
Format For Time - H:i
Format For Registration Date - M Y
Format For Birthdays with Year Specified - F j, Y
Format For Birthdays with Year Unspecified - F j
Log Date Format - H:i, jS M Y
EDIT: After reading through a few posts here and on vb.com a common suggestion is the usercp level configuration items, having checked a few accounts (all users are seeing incorrect times) the settings are:
Time Zone: (GMT) Western Europe Time, London, Lisbon, Casablanca
DST Correction Option: Automatically detect DST settings
Which I believe to be correct